A gunman shot Prime Minister Robert Fico of Slovakia, who is understood for defying his fellow leaders within the European Union, a number of instances at shut vary on Wednesday, in essentially the most critical assault on a European chief in many years.
Mr. Fico was shot after rising from the Home of Tradition in Handlova, a city in central Slovakia, as he greeted a small crowd in Banikov Sq.. He was rushed to a close-by hospital, then airlifted to a different hospital for emergency surgical procedure.
Hours later, the deputy prime minister, Tomas Taraba, advised the BBC that Mr. Fico’s scenario was now not life-threatening, and he anticipated the prime minister to outlive.
The gunman, recognized by Slovak information retailers as a 71-year-old poet, was instantly wrestled to the bottom by safety officers.
The inside minister, Matus Sutaj Estok, mentioned at a information convention that Mr. Fico was shot 5 instances and that the preliminary proof “clearly factors to a political motivation.” Requested to call the attacker, he mentioned, “Not at this time.”
The tried assassination stoked fears that Europe’s more and more polarized and venomous political debates had tipped into violence.
Mr. Fico started his three-decade political profession as a leftist however over time shifted to the precise. He served as prime minister from 2006 to 2010 and from 2012 to 2018, earlier than returning to energy in elections final yr. After being ousted amid road protests in 2018, he was re-elected on a platform of social conservatism, nationalism and guarantees of beneficiant welfare applications.
His opposition to army assist for Ukraine, pleasant relations with President Vladimir V. Putin of Russia and different positions have put him exterior the European mainstream. Like his ally Viktor Orban, the prime minister of Hungary, Mr. Fico has been a frequent critic of the European Union.
Like Mr. Orban and the Dutch far-right chief Geert Wilders, Mr. Fico has delighted in presenting himself as a pugnacious fighter for the widespread man, a forthright enemy of liberal elites and a bulwark in opposition to immigration from exterior Europe, notably by Muslims.
His critics have accused Mr. Fico of undermining the independence of the information media, opposed his efforts to limit international funding of civic organizations and referred to as him a risk to democracy. They accuse Mr. Fico of searching for to take Slovakia again to the repressive days of the Soviet bloc.
Mr. Fico’s political profession seemed to be over after his ouster in 2018, however he discovered new assist final yr by selling anti-L.G.B.T.Q. positions, attacking the European Union as a risk to nationwide sovereignty and opposing the continued provide of weapons to Ukraine.
In his tenure as prime minister, Slovakia grew to become the primary nation to cease sending weapons to Ukraine, although nonmilitary help continued.
His return to energy final yr mirrored a wider development throughout a lot of Europe: the decline of assist for center-left and center-right events that calmly traded locations after elections and agreed on most issues.
The capturing was captured on movies, which present Mr. Fico, 59, approaching a small group of individuals behind a waist-high steel barrier, when an older man stepped ahead and fired a handgun from just some toes away.
On a video from Radio and Tv of Slovakia, a public broadcaster, and verified by The New York Occasions, 5 obvious gunshots might be heard.
With the primary bang, Mr. Fico doubled over on the waist and fell backward onto a bench as extra have been heard. Safety officers then hustled him right into a black Audi a number of toes away, half-carrying him to the automotive’s rear door.
A put up on the prime minister’s official and verified Fb web page mentioned that Mr. Fico was in “life-threatening situation.” “The subsequent few hours will determine,” the put up mentioned. Authorities officers didn’t say what a part of his physique was hit.
There was no fast remark from the police in regards to the assault, essentially the most critical try on the lifetime of a European head of presidency since Prime Minister Zoran Djindjic of Serbia was assassinated in 2003.
The capturing drew a refrain of condemnation from world leaders, together with President Biden, who referred to as it a “horrific act of violence,” and Mr. Putin, who lauded Mr. Fico as a “brave and strong-minded man.”
The president of Slovakia, Zuzana Caputova, whose place is basically ceremonial, mentioned in an announcement, “The capturing of the prime minister is at the beginning an assault on a human being — however it’s additionally an assault on democracy.”
A few of Mr. Fico’s allies in Parliament prompt that his liberal opponents had created the ambiance for the capturing.
Michal Simecka, the chairman of the opposition celebration Progressive Slovakia, mentioned he shared within the “horror” of the assault however warned in opposition to spreading “false info” in regards to the assailant. In a put up on the social-media platform X, he burdened that the attacker was not a member of his motion or related to his celebration in any method.
Mr. Fico stepped down as prime minister in 2018, after weeks of mass demonstrations over the murders of a journalist, who was uncovering authorities corruption, and his fiancée. Protesters mentioned the federal government was not interested by fixing the crime. A number of individuals have been later convicted of involvement within the murders, however a businessman accused of orchestrating them was acquitted.
